In the Trial Garden



Snapdragons ‘Chantilly’


Heliotrope ‘Deep Marine’

While the weather is miserably cold and wet in our northern California location, there are still things to do in the trial garden. All the different new color combinations of California poppies and sweet peas we seeded last October and November are ready for thinning before they get too crowded. We have found rigorously thinning these seedlings allows plants enough room to grow to their full size and bloom abundantly over a longer period. We thin out California poppies to 4-6 inches apart and sweet peas to stand 6 inches apart.

We have also sown several early spring flower seeds in our greenhouse:
Stock ‘Ten Week Bouquet’ , Snapdragons ‘Chantilly’and Heliotrope ‘Deep Marine’ are all easy to grow, colorful and fragrant varieties that will look lovely when planted in the landscape later this season.
